MULTIPLE TOPICS AND GENERAL INFORMATION
Reference Books
- World at Risk: A Global Issues Sourcebook R 327 WORLD 2002.
- Essays and statistics on problems such as deforestation, genocide, human rights, hunger, literacy. Essays provide background, current status (research, policies), regional summaries, data, case studies, websites and documents.
- World Development Indicators R 330.9172 WORLD INDICATOR yearly
- Statistics and social history of developing countries. Published yearly by World Bank, very comprehensive. Online access to selected indicators from current year at: http://www.worldbank.org/data/dataquery.html
- Countries and Their Cultures 2001 R 306.03 COUNTRI 4 vols.
- Thorough overview from a sociological perspective. Covers topics such as ethnic relations, urbanism, economy, social stratification, gender, marriage, health.
- Encyclopedia Britannica Book of the Year R 021 BRITANN yearly
- Has charts comparing all the countries of the world on various measures as well a one page on each country with detailed statistical information.
- Routledge International Encyclopedia of Women: Global Women's Issues and Knowledge. 4 vols. R 305.403 ROUTLED 2000
- Organized by issue and topic then region or country, e.g. “Education: Sub-Saharan Africa”. Use index by country to locate information on specific topics.

GLOBAL ECONOMY
- World Development Report R 330.9172 WORLD D Yearly.
- Older copies circulate and may contain essays on your topics.
- World Development Indicators R 330.9172 WORLD INDICATOR
- Statistics and social history of developing countries. Received yearly, very comprehensive.
- Global Competitiveness Report R 338.905 GLOBAL
- Comparative essays, year in review, country profiles ranking each country according to business factors such as openness, government, finance, infrastructure, technology, management, labor and institutions. Each factor is further broken down, e.g. under “Labor” factors are work ethic, average years of schooling, and collective bargaining.
- Demystifying the global Economy: A Guide for Students. 337 OCONNOR 2002
- Good clear introduction with resource list, websites, glossary, abbreviations, and timeline.
- Globalization and Its Discontents 337 STIGLITZ 2002
- Critique of globalization by a winner of the Nobel Prize in Economics
- In Defense of Globalization 337 BHAGWATI 2004
- An economist's defense of globalization as a powerful force for social good.

POPULATION
- World Development Report (listed under GLOBAL ECONOMY)
-
- WorldWatch Insitute website and publications
-
- UNFPA: United Nations Population Fund
http://www.unfpa.org/index.htm
- Information about population issues such as sustainable development and reproductive health as well as reports on projects in specific countries.
- Population Reference Bureau
http://www.prb.org/
- Statistical data and produces reports on U.S. and international population trends and their implications. Information and reports are listed by topic and by region. Database of statistics by country at Datafinder http://www.prb.org/datafind/datafinder5.htm
- Population Action International
http://www.populationaction.org/
- Reports, information, and statistics on world population, concentrating on population growth, reproductive health and family planning, population and environment, population and economic conditions, and women's health and education.
